Understanding the Body’s 24-Hour Biological Rhythms and Their Impact on Performance

The Significance of Circadian Rhythms in Daily Function

Our bodies follow a clock called the circadian rhythm, a zero-in on how hormones, alertness, and sleep ebb and flow. Every organ and cell in your body works on this schedule, reaching peaks and valleys in activity. For example, your hormone levels and energy production are higher during the day and dip at night. Understanding this makes it easier to plan your most demanding tasks when your biology can support them best.

The Impact of Light and Temperature Cycles

Sunlight drives this internal clock. When you experience sunlight in the morning, your brain recognizes it as a signal to wake, and at the same time, your melatonin, the sleep hormone, levels decrease. In addition to exposure to sunlight, ultraviolet light and the photons from sunlight stimulate the neurons that regulate mood and alertness. During the day, your body temperature increases and decreases, with the peak occurring in the late afternoon and the lowest point around nighttime, signaling sleep. If you ignore these internal cycles, you may experience a lower energy level, worse sleep, and fewer focusing abilities.


The Importance of the Temperature Minimum

The other key component is the "temperature minimum," which is the lowest body temperature in a day. This temperature minimum generally occurs about 2 hours before you usually wake up. If you can understand when your minimum usually occurs, then you will be able to find your ideal window for focus or rest, as well as work. When your temperature increases after this minimum, your alertness increases as well. Knowing more about how this concept works will help you schedule your most intense work activity when your body is in its optimal position.

Morning Practices for Improved Alertness and Focus

Documenting Wake Time and Temperature Minimum

It is essential to note when you get up each day. This is not just to develop a habit, but also for identifying your biological lows. Knowing when you wake helps you align your routines to your innate frequencies. Our target is to schedule our activities to our body's downward and upward energy cycles as much as possible to take advantage of wakefulness and clarity.


Morning Sun and Forward Movement 

Once you wake up and get out of bed, make sure you're outside for a walk. Your walk is more than simply physical exercise; it is a cognitive enhancer. When we step forward in space, our eyes connect to visual flow, which acts to diminish any anxious activity in the portions of our brain linked to fear and stress. Sun exposure is important here too, as sunlight releases cortisol, one of the main hormones that promote wakefulness. A simple 10-minute stroll on a bright, sunny morning can help set the day in a positive direction.

Water & Caffeine Timing

Hydration is crucial to optimal brain function. A glass of water with a dash of sea salt early on will help your neurons maintain their ionic balance—sodium, magnesium, potassium—required to focus. After about 90 minutes of waking, consider delaying caffeine. Caffeine inhibits adenosine, a sleep-promoting chemical that begins to accumulate during waking hours. Waiting helps prevent crashes and allows energy to persistently stay elevated throughout all waking hours and activities.

Arranging Your Workday to Be Most Productive

Leverage Your 90-Minute Altradian Cycle

Typically, your brain works in cycles, called ultradian rhythms, of about 90 minutes. In these cycles, you are concentrated for a while and much less concentrated in the next. If you plan your current work to correspond to these cycles and give yourself 90-minute blocks, then you may be able to achieve a level of “flow” during those blocks. Within that 90-minute cycle, you have to be diligent in eliminating as many distractions as possible and completely immerse yourself in the current task. Once you finish a cycle, give yourself permission to have a rest or do something that is less cognitively taxing.

Evening/Nighttime Protocols for Good Sleep

Light Management/Retinal Sensitivity

Get outside at some point in the late afternoon or early evening and look into the sunlight. This should reduce your sensitivity to bright lights later that night. This exposure to sunlight allows your brain to produce melatonin naturally, rather than being disrupted by phones and screens. You'll also want to turn off screens and dim the lights before bed, so that your brain can complete this process uninterrupted.

The Significance of Temperature Drop for Easy Sleep Onset

In order to sleep well, your core body temperature needs to drop about 1-3°C. Cold baths, hot then cold showers, or sauna sessions followed by cold rooms or a cold chest will assist with this process. When you exit the hot bath or shower, your body cools down, making the temperature drop and thus sleep onset easier. Therefore, take all the necessary measures to support this temperature drop, like a cool room, proper blackout curtains, and avoiding bright screens before bed.

Supplementation and Other Natural Sleep Aids

Several natural compounds can help you ease yourself to asleep faster. For example, magnesium supplementation (especially glycinate or threonate) can enhance your GABA (inhibitory neurotransmitter or neuromodulator) signalling, giving you that sense of peacefulness that should characterise sleep. The recommended dose is usually 300-400 mg taken about 30–60 minutes before bedtime, and should aid in ruminating thoughts beforehand. Similarly, apigenin (from chamomile) and theanine also enhance signals of calmness in your brain, allowing sleep scheduling to occur naturally.

Managing Waking in the Middle of the Night

It is common to wake in the middle of the night, typically due to melatonin cycles or anxious thinking. If you find yourself awake, avoid bright lights (use very dim white light or red light if you need to, even just to assess the situation). Getting back in bed as soon as possible and keeping the environment dark will help you sleep again (note: this may seem contradictory). Don't stress about it. You can't influence waking hours, but you can control creating a sleep environment and sleep habits.
